How do we know what they know?

Over the years, we’ve seen a clear reaction to economic downturn.  If customers aren’t buying, retailers cut training.  Why?  I think it’s because from the outset the value or specific financial impact of solving a particular problem through training hasn’t been quantified.  Many of our clients are initially excited about our ability to measure training…
